PESHAWAR: Prime Minister Imran Khan said on Wednesday that the Opposition had demanded a “34-page NRO” when he offered to engage in dialogue.
The premier made the statement while talking to reports during his day-long Peshawar visit. “I would never bow down under any circumstances,” he asserted. The cases against the Opposition were not filed during our government [but] were registered in the past, he said, adding that there was no threat to the PTI regime from them.

ISLAMABAD: As the Pakistan Democratic Movement (PDM) put on a show of power at Lahore’s Minar-e-Pakistan, the PTI-led government’s ministers and officials took jibes at the opposition coalition.
Speaking to Geo News, Information and Broadcasting Minister Senator Shibli Faraz said the atmosphere at the PDM’s Lahore jalsa was as cold as today’s weather . People have used the right to vote against them, Faraz said, adding that the opposition was unable to gather more than 10,000 to 15,000 people. Lahore has outright dismissed them. Lahore has rejected Maryam Nawaz, he commented, adding that while the atmosphere could be heated up on the television, it was cold at the venue.
